Cold

  • Light: Battery powered over candles 
  • Heat: Blankets, indoor heaters, generators, fireplace 
  • Water: Hydration is VERY important when its cold. 
  • Food: Ensure propane tanks are full if you need to use outdoor cooking appliances 
  • Car: fill up your gas tank and have a car kit with needed emergency supplies
